    Cesar Pattein, French 1850-1931

    A son of a farmer, Cesar Pattein was born in Steenvoorde, France. Following the example of his artistic brothers, he studied engraving from a local artist by the name of Cabasson. In 1878 he was accepted at the Ecole des Beaux-Arts in Lille under Alphonse Colas, a painter of genre subjects. Pattein as also a student of Jules Breton, a painter of poetic landscapes and of human nature. Breton was to influence his use of the peasants as subject material
